ARB IOT Group Limited (ARBB) closed at $4.61 on the latest session, a decline of 0.86% from the previous close. The stock now sits just above its identified support level of $4.38, while resistance remains at $4.84. This modest pullback occurs amid steady trading activity, with the price action suggesting a potential test of the lower boundary of its recent range.

Technically, ARBB is trading in the middle to lower portion of its established range. The support level at $4.38 has been tested multiple times in recent weeks and represents a key floor where buyers have historically stepped in. On the upside, resistance at $4.84 continues to cap advances, creating a tight trading band. The price action pattern shows a series of lower highs since the last resistance test, suggesting a short-term bearish bias. Momentum indicators are generally neutral but leaning toward the soft side. For instance, the Relative Strength Index (RSI) is likely in the mid‑40s range, reflecting neither overbought nor oversold conditions but a slight bearish tilt. Moving averages may be flat or slightly negatively sloped, with the 50‑day moving average acting as overhead resistance in the $4.70–$4.80 area. Additionally, the stock has formed a potential descending triangle pattern, where a series of lower highs converge on a flat support level. A decisive close below $4.38 could confirm this pattern’s bearish implications, while a bounce from support with increasing volume might suggest a false breakdown or accumulation underway. Looking ahead, ARBB’s near‑term trajectory largely hinges on whether the $4.38 support level holds. If the stock continues to respect this floor, a rebound toward the $4.84 resistance is a possible scenario, especially if broader market sentiment improves or sector‑specific catalysts emerge. Conversely, a sustained break below $4.38 could open the door to further downside, with the next logical support potentially around the $4.00 psychological level. Factors that may influence future performance include upcoming financial results, product or contract announcements from the company, and overall investor appetite for small‑cap technology equities. The stock’s low float and periodic volatility mean that any news — positive or negative — could lead to sharp movements. Traders may watch for volume surges as a confirmation signal. It is important to note that while the current setup suggests a cautious outlook, a strong catalyst could quickly shift momentum, pushing the stock back toward resistance.
